Transaction d77988035bcea13666bba11ab1b0372f4dc289cc6029cba18e31452e9c0ff944
1 Input
1 Output
-
d77988035bcea13666bba11ab1b0372f4dc289cc6029cba18e31452e9c0ff944:0
- value
- 831099
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1511625b89b2ebb82655ff828f7087304e57c4a
- address
- bc1q69g3vfdcnvhthqn9tluz3acgwvzw2lz2npdflh